There's lots of guidebooks on how to write a script -- but not all screenwriters follow them. You're already doing the basics: planning our your narrative and researching it. There's lots of ways to get to a fully polished script -- you could write your idea out as a short story (this is like "doing a treatment"). You could do photographic or drawn storyboards (like a comic) sketching each scene. You could invite some actors to improvise scenes and videotape them as source material. |
